MUI vs HeroUI: Which UI Library Actually Scales?

Editor | February 26, 2026 | 2 min read

Choosing a UI library is not just a design decision. It affects engineering speed, onboarding, testing effort, and how painful refactoring becomes six months later. The MUI vs HeroUI decision is often framed as "enterprise vs lightweight," but that summary hides the real tradeoffs teams feel in daily work.

In this guide, the focus is simple: what holds up when a project grows. Not in a demo, but in a codebase with multiple contributors, changing requirements, and delivery pressure.

Quick Comparison
  • MUI (Material UI): opinionated, structured, enterprise-friendly
  • HeroUI: lightweight, flexible, Tailwind-first
  • Main tradeoff: consistency and guardrails vs speed and freedom
Philosophy: Why These Libraries Feel Different

MUI is built around consistency. It gives you system-level defaults for components, spacing, theming, and interaction patterns. That makes it easier to keep the product visually coherent when multiple engineers are shipping in parallel.

HeroUI is built around flexibility. It assumes your team wants lighter abstractions and tight control over styling decisions, usually through Tailwind. The benefit is faster customization. The cost is that design consistency depends more on team discipline than framework defaults.

In practice, this difference shows up quickly. If your team asks, "What is the standard way to build this?" MUI has a clearer answer. If your team asks, "How quickly can we shape this exactly how we want?" HeroUI often feels faster.

Developer Experience at Scale
MUI

MUI performs well in team settings where predictability matters. New contributors can follow established component patterns without guessing. Theme tokens and component APIs create shared language across contributors.

Strengths:

  • Centralized theming
  • Predictable component behavior
  • Mature documentation and examples
  • Easier onboarding for larger teams

Common friction:

  • Heavier abstraction can feel restrictive for highly custom UI
  • Deep overrides can become noisy when design diverges from defaults
HeroUI

HeroUI feels efficient for small teams and fast iteration. You can move from idea to working UI quickly without dealing with large component APIs. Tailwind-first composition can reduce mental overhead when the team is already fluent in utility classes.

Strengths:

  • Low abstraction, fast composition
  • Good fit for custom interfaces
  • Smaller cognitive load for solo or small teams

Common friction:

  • Fewer guardrails means consistency can drift across features
  • Large teams may need stricter internal conventions to avoid UI fragmentation
Performance and Bundle Behavior

Performance is not only about one benchmark. It is about long-term bundle growth, runtime cost, and how easy it is to keep things lean while features expand.

MUI typically starts heavier because you get more infrastructure out of the box. That can be a fair tradeoff when the product needs strong consistency and predictable UI behavior.

HeroUI usually begins lighter and keeps a smaller default footprint. For performance-sensitive products, this can be a meaningful advantage. But lower library overhead does not automatically guarantee a faster app if implementation choices are inconsistent.

Practical rule: if performance budget is tight and UI complexity is moderate, HeroUI often gives better defaults. If UI governance and consistency are hard requirements, MUI's extra weight may be justified.

Team Fit and Maintainability

This is where decisions become obvious.

Choose MUI when:

  • Team size is medium to large
  • You need strict design consistency
  • You are building long-lived, process-heavy products
  • Standardization is more valuable than per-screen freedom

Choose HeroUI when:

  • Team is solo or small
  • Iteration speed is the top priority
  • You expect custom visual patterns frequently
  • You can enforce consistency through internal conventions
Real-World Decision Framework

Use these two questions before deciding:

  1. Will this product be maintained by many people over time?
  2. Do we need strict visual governance or rapid UI experimentation?

If the first answer is yes, MUI is usually safer. If the second answer dominates, HeroUI usually gives better velocity.

A practical approach for many teams is hybrid adoption at the organization level: MUI for internal/admin-heavy systems, HeroUI for lightweight product surfaces where custom UX and shipping speed matter most.
